Block Name: Rainbow Pinot Gris (upper)
Variety: Pinot Gris
Clone: unknown
Year Planted: 1985
Trellis Type: Single High Wire
Soil: Volcanic
Fun Fact: The fruit notes expressed by this Pinot Gris on the volcanic soil are usually more of the stone fruit variety while the fruit notes expressed by the Pinot Gris on the marine sedimentary soil are more citrus-like. Together they create a dynamic wine.
